CREAM PUFFS
Steps:
- To make the cream puffs: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F. In a large saucepan, bring the water, butter, salt, and granulated sugar to a rolling boil over medium-high heat. When it boils, immediately take the pan off the heat. Stirring with a wooden spoon, add all the flour at once and stir hard until all the flour is incorporated, 30 to 60 seconds. Return the pan to the heat and cook, stirring, 30 seconds to evaporate some of the moisture.
- Scrape the mixture into a mixer fitted with a paddle attachment. Mix at medium speed. With the mixer running, and working 1 egg at a time, add 3 of the eggs, stopping after each addition to scrape down the sides of the bowl. Mix until the dough is smooth and glossy and the eggs are completely incorporated. The dough should be thick, but should fall slowly and steadily from the beaters when you lift them out of the bowl. If the dough is still clinging to the beaters, add the remaining egg and mix until incorporated.
- Using a pastry bag fitted with a large plain tip, pipe the dough onto the baking sheet, in 2-inch diameter rounds or balls. Whisk the remaining egg with 1 1/2 teaspoons water. Brush the surface of the rounds with the egg wash to knock down the points (you may not use all the egg wash). Bake 15 minutes, then reduce the heat to 375 degrees F and bake until puffed up, and light golden brown, about 20 minutes more. Try not to open the oven door too often during the baking. Let cool on the baking sheet.
- To fill the cream puffs, place a pastry tip on your finger and poke a whole in the bottom of each puff. Whip the cream with the sugar and vanilla until stiff. Pipe whipped cream into each cream puff and chill until ready to serve, no more than 4 hours.
- Notes about the recipe: The moisture in the eggs turns to steam and puffs the batter to try to release itself. You can fill them with anything.

CREAM PUFFS
Steps:
- Position rack in center of oven. Preheat oven to 425 degrees. Cut a piece of parchment paper to fit a non-air-cushioned baking sheet. Lightly butter the baking sheet and cover with the paper. Fit a pastry bag with 1-inch tip.
- In a 2-quart saucepan, bring water, salt and butter just to a boil so that butter melts. Remove from heat. Add the flour all at once and beat vigorously with a wooden spoon just until blended.
- Return pan to stove and continue to beat over low heat until the mixture is smooth, shiny and pulls away from sides of pan, about 30 seconds.
- Remove from heat. Beat in eggs, one at a time. Make sure each is fully incorporated. The finished dough will look shiny.
- To fill the pastry bag, fold top third of the bag down over your hand and scrape the dough into the bag with a spatula. When two-thirds full, twirl the top of the bag until all the air is out. Continue to twirl the bag and apply pressure with one hand, using your other hand to steady the tip. Gently squeeze dough onto the baking sheet to form 13 1 1/2-inch mounds.
- Bake for 20 minutes.
- Remove from oven. Slit puffs on either side about halfway through with the tip of a sharp knife. Return puffs to oven for 15 minutes. Remove to cooling rack. When cool, split in half from side to side.
- The puffs should be light and browned. If there is any wet dough, pull it out with fingers.

CREAM PUFF DOUGH
This dough is used to make cream Puffs, Eclairs, Paris-Brest and Gateau St-Honore and can be filled with "Recipe #363296" And you can dip them in Pol Martins Caramel Coated Cream Puffs, recipe will follow. Steps:
- preheat oven to 375*F butter and lightly flour a cookie sheet.
- place water, salt, butter and sugar in heavy-bottomed saucepan. cook over medium heat. continue cooking for 2 minutes after liquid starts to boil.
- reduce heat to low. add all of flour and mix rapidly with wooden spoon. cook dough until it no longer sticks to the spoon or fingers when pinched. be sure to mix constantly.
- remove pan from heat and transfer mixture to bowl. let cool 3 minutes.
- incorporate eggs one at a time, (mixture must regain its smooth texture before next egg is added) mixing well between additions. the finished dough should be shiny and smooth.
- fit pastry bag with plain rounded tip. fill pastry bag with dough and squeeze out shapes of your choice; the size of an egg for cream puffs or 4inch long strips for eclairs. leave space between each.
- brush tops of shapes with beaten egg, smooth tails left by pastry bag. let stand at room temperature for 20 minutes.
- bake 35 minutes in oven. turn off heat and postion door ajar. let stand 45 minutes.
- when cold fill with your choice of pastry cream or whipped cream. glaze tops with caramel or chocolate.
